I picked up an Intel DG45ID for my HTPC setup and it does not support the Q9550 processor. I swapped out the processor with a 9650 and it doesn't work either. However it works fine with a 9450.

When I power on the system with the 9550 or 9650 the board throws me a message that the processor is not supported by the board and that I should check the processor compatibility list for the motherboard. I did this and Q9650 and Q9550 are reported as being supported.
